E141 ACA is a 1988 Citroen C15 in Red with a 1,124cc petrol engine. This vehicle has been through 27 MOT tests with a personal pass rate of 59.3%.
Across all 1988 Citroen C15 models, the average MOT pass rate is 57.4% with a typical mileage of 91,095 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Citroen C15 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 8,845 recorded failures. If you're considering buying E141 ACA, it's worth having these areas checked by a mechanic before committing.
The Citroen C15 typically stays on UK roads for around 37 years. At 38 years old, this Citroen C15 is approaching the upper end of the typical lifespan for this model.
